What is Mary's mini diet?

4 min read
Created by Dr. John and Mary McDougall, the Mary's mini diet is a short-term, simplified eating plan designed to reset your dietary habits and promote weight loss. It is often used as a way to kickstart a whole-food, plant-based (WFPB) lifestyle or break a weight loss plateau.
